A markup language for ER diagrams.
-
Install graphviz
brew install graphviz
-
Clone the Repo / Download the Repository
git clone https://github.com/lewismazzei/entr.git
-
Change Directory
cd entr
-
Create and activate virtual environment
python3 -m venv venv
source venv/bin/activate
-
Install dependencies
pip install -r requirements.txt
-
Change directory
cd src
-
Run
python entr.py <entr_document_filepath> <png|jpg>
The generated .dot
and .png
/ .jpg
files will be placed in an output/dot
and output/png
/ output/jpg
directory respectively.